Medical Collaboration in Africa - Another Great Idea

Fri. 8/5 at 8am: Our guests are Dr Robert Glew Professor of Biochemistry and Microbiology and Research Associate Professor Dorothy VanderJagt Nutritionist, both are from the Department of Biochemistry and Molecular Biology at the UNM Medical School.

Drs Glew and VanderJagt developed a "Scholars Program" that introduced students from the University of New Mexico with health issues in Nigeria. Their research was done in collaboration with young physicians and faculty, at the University of Jos. Our guests explain why they chose the University of Jos for the study of maternal/child health problems, fatty acid metabolism, sickle cell anemia, maternal/child health, nutrition assessment, and body composition in sub-Saharan Africa. Professors Glew and VanderJagt discuss their remarkable achievements made both in Africa and New Mexico as a result of their research collaboration.
